This church was originally built in 1865 as a chapel that was nearby the original mission, which has since burned down. The site is down a steep dirt road and also has a original orno or stove on site. Taking off one point though because there are definitely a lot of mosquitoes and remaining in the chapel is almost impossible due to the swarms of mosquitoes you are bound to encounter. Another group of visitors was forced to leave because of how many were there. Conclusion? Come check out the mission but please bring bug spray!

There are two parts to this stop. First, the historic mission by the river. The primary building is a sweet little chapel that has been relatively well maintained. Unfortunately there are large trash cans all over that get in the way of almost every picture. Then about a half mike away are the remains of the Abbey that was eventually turned into a mental hospital, then burned down. Unfortunately they had access blocked when we visited, but you can see the ruins from the road. I'm not sure access allowed when the school is open.
